What’s so special about these controls? Why will your life and bike not be complete without them? Well, let’s start here: They’re handmade. They’re not stamped out of some big machine like they’re being extruded from a Play-doh pumper. They’re individually cut and assembled which keeps quality high and reduces the chance of equipment failure. They’re coated with a military-grade flat black finish that is just this side of indestructible. It’s one of the most wear-resistant finishes in the industry. The foot peg has serrated bear trap edges to reduce slipping, not to mention reduce the chances you’ll like a dork.
